    Beginning with Archer Platform Release 2024.03, the version number can be found in the “About Archer” menu under the User Profile dropdown. In this numbering system we're using a four-digit year and two-digit month.

    The full engineering build number, if needed for investigation or troubleshooting, can be obtained by clicking the “Copy” link and pasting the content.

    The full engineering build number is what changes when an Update Release, such as 2025.06.02, is applied

    6.15.00702.10324 is the build number for 2025.06 Update Release 2 which should be displayed for any instances that reside in SaaS NonProduction environments. Test instances reside in SaaS NonProduction so you are seeing the correct build number when you press Copy. And yes, the version will say 2025.06.

    All SaaS Production environments are on 2025.04 UR 3 until the Production upgrades to 2025.06 UR2 take place.

    There you will see:

    Version: 2025.04

    Build: 6.15.00603.10306
